    Oneplus 7 Pro

    Overall I like it, had it for about 2 years now and bought it used. I usually buy 1-2 year old flagship phones since they get so cheap.

    Plusses:

    • It was cheap
    • Battery easily lasts me a day
    • Feels nice to hold
    • Screen is huge
    • It’s still very fast/responsive
    • Charges fast

    Negatives:

    • The curved edges on the screen can make it hard to hold, and cause random touches sometimes
    • Fast charging is their stupid proprietary VOOC thing, finding any chargers that support it is hard
    • Screen washes out contrast when in 90hz mode and looks bad
    • Camera often looks really over sharpened and artificial, while having way too much noise reduction applied, video is pretty poor with the same issues. Just normal smartphone camera things.

    Other phones I’ve had were an Essential PH-1, LG V10, Samsung Galaxy S3, and HTC Dream. By far the worst was the Samsung, their OS has improved since but back then it was absolutely awful. Favorite was the LG V10, that was such a great phone and felt like you could chuck it at a wall without any damage.

    I tried an iPad once but their OS is really frustrating, trying to do any normal stuff like just have access to a filesystem to store/sync items is impossible.
